晚期糖基化终末产物受体在子宫内膜癌中的作用:综述

Role of Receptor for Advanced Glycation End-Products in Endometrial Cancer: A Review

英文摘要:

Endometrial cancer (EC) is the most common gynecological malignancy. EC is associated with metabolic disorders that may promote non-enzymatic glycation and activate the receptor for advanced glycation end-products (RAGE) signaling pathways. Thus, we assumed that RAGE and its ligands may contribute to EC. Of particular interest is the interaction between diaphanous-related formin 1 (Diaph1) and RAGE during the progression of human cancers. Diaph1 is engaged in the proper organization of actin cytoskeletal dynamics, which is crucial in cancer invasion, metastasis, angiogenesis, and axonogenesis. However, the detailed molecular role of RAGE in EC remains uncertain. In this review, we discuss epigenetic factors that may play a key role in the RAGE-dependent endometrial pathology. We propose that DNA methylation may regulate the activity of the RAGE pathway in the uterus. The accumulation of negative external factors, such as hyperglycemia, inflammation, and oxidative stress, may interfere with the DNA methylation process. Therefore, further research should take into account the role of epigenetic mechanisms in EC progression.

 

摘要翻译: 

子宫内膜癌(EC)是最常见的妇科恶性肿瘤。EC与代谢紊乱相关,这些紊乱可能促进非酶糖基化并激活晚期糖基化终末产物受体(RAGE)信号通路。因此,我们推测RAGE及其配体可能在EC的发生发展中发挥作用。尤其值得关注的是,在人类癌症进展过程中,透明相关formin 1(Diaph1)与RAGE之间的相互作用。Diaph1参与肌动蛋白细胞骨架动力学的正确组织,这对癌症侵袭、转移、血管生成和轴突生成至关重要。然而,RAGE在EC中的具体分子作用仍不明确。本综述讨论了可能在RAGE依赖性子宫内膜病理中起关键作用的表观遗传因素。我们提出,DNA甲基化可能调控子宫中RAGE通路的活性。高血糖、炎症和氧化应激等负面外部因素的积累可能干扰DNA甲基化过程。因此,进一步研究应考虑表观遗传机制在EC进展中的作用。
